So this all started with an end-user, asked to install JBoss Tools, went to the update site and selected only "All JBoss Tools" and then discovered, much to his surprise that several things were missing.

Now, I have another end-user, who when asked to install JBoss Tools, went to the update site and selected everything but "Abridged" because he wanted everything, just the subset.  Therefore, he checked all the other boxes and found, much to his surprise that several things were missing.

So, does Abridged now include "Everything you really need minus the experimental stuff"?  Then it is back to being "All".

In general, competing Eclipse tool distributions do not have this many categories and the confusion.  You either want the bundle (e.g. JBoss Tools) or not.
